Output efd93233b58c2db5cf1935b5cb59093ecf96cd080b54762b752dfb0f010cbd2d:1

value
68986
script pubkey
OP_0 OP_PUSHBYTES_20 c563b66ed18dfb418fabc3b5f2f4e10661e9c8ba
address
bc1qc43mvmk33ha5rratcw6l9a8pqes7nj96t28zku
transaction
efd93233b58c2db5cf1935b5cb59093ecf96cd080b54762b752dfb0f010cbd2d
confirmations
332306
spent
true